Welche Version nenne ich da oben? Richtig 1:3.8.1p1-8.sarge.1:

openssh (1:3.8.1p1-8.sarge.1) unstable; urgency=high

  * If PasswordAuthentication is disabled, then offer to disable
    ChallengeResponseAuthentication too. The current PAM code will attempt 
    password-style authentication if ChallengeResponseAuthentication is
    enabled (closes: #250369).
  * This will ask a question of anyone who installed fresh with 1:3.8p1-2 or
    later and then upgraded. Sorry about that ... for this reason, the
    default answer is to leave ChallengeResponseAuthentication enabled.

Da lese ich das eigentlich raus, dass man jetzt
ChallengeResponseAuthentication setzen muss.
